The Bible tells us that we do not wrestle against flesh and blood, but against principalities, against powers, against the rulers of the darkness of this world, and against spiritual forces of wickedness in the heavenly places (Ephesians 6:12). It is clear that the enemy seeks to steal, kill, and destroy (John 10:10), and frustration is one of his tactics to wear us down and distract us from God’s purpose.
However, we must also examine our own hearts and lives to ensure there is no sin or disobedience that may be giving the enemy a foothold (Ephesians 4:27). Have you sought the Lord in prayer and His Word to discern if there is an area where He may be refining you or redirecting your path? Sometimes what feels like an obstacle is actually God’s protection or a lesson in patience and trust. The psalmist reminds us, "The steps of a good man are ordered by the Lord, and He delights in his way. Though he fall, he shall not be utterly cast down; for the Lord upholds him with His hand" (Psalm 37:23-24). Even in the midst of frustration, we can trust that God is sovereign and working all things together for our good (Romans 8:28).
